[PATCH v2 3/4] irqchip: sun4i: Fix a comment about mask register initialization

From: Hans de Goede
Date: Wed Mar 12 2014 - 13:17:47 EST


The comment was claiming that we were masking all irqs, while the code actually
*un*masks all of them.
